Crystallization
Crystallization on EC 3.8.1.10 - 2-haloacid dehalogenase (configuration-inverting)

purified recombinant native and selenomethionine-labeled wild-type enzyme and recombinant D194N enzyme mutant complexed with inhibitor 2-bromo-2-methylpropionate, 15 mg/mL protein in 10 mM Hepes-NaOH, pH 7.5, is mixed with 3 M sodium formate, 5% glycerol v/v, as the reservoir solution, X-ray diffraction structure determination and analysis at 1.7-2.7 A resolution
purified enzyme, sitting drop vapour diffusion method, mixing of equal volumes of 9 mg/ml protein in 50 mM Tris, pH 8.0, and 25 mM NaCl, and of reservoir solution consisting of 0.2 M MgCl2 hexahydrate, 20-26% PEG 4000, 0.1 M Tris, pH 8.5, and equilibration against 0.1 ml of reservoir solution, 4°C, overnight, soaking of crystals in KI, X-ray diffraction structure determination and analysis at 1.98-2.0 A resolution, single-wavelength anomalous dispersion method, modeling
